I think people mostly remember the 3 interceptions that were returned for TD's. But there were actually four touchdowns by the defense. Chris Shelling recovered a fumble in the endzone in the first half for Auburn.

I think Auburn intercepted 5 passes in all. LSU had a few last ditch efforts in that game. They were driving in Auburn territory and Howard threw another pick to Brian Robinson. Robinson was stripped of the ball on his return and LSU got it back. After a completion to around the 30 yard line, Howard went to the endzone and was picked off one last time by Chris Shelling. That would do it as there was only about 25 seconds left in the game.
